Transaction 51a5151b4a8d7570dec34e5a16a113e03cae3ddee86cc5fadfaaf48df28ec384

3 Input
2 Outputs
  • 51a5151b4a8d7570dec34e5a16a113e03cae3ddee86cc5fadfaaf48df28ec384:0
  • value  2781951
    address  1E1qP3kvuymKMrmHXRCFCLPr3o3EaeEJJS
  • 51a5151b4a8d7570dec34e5a16a113e03cae3ddee86cc5fadfaaf48df28ec384:1
  • value  1096416
    address  1ARpqbVkkZDzghuaN6D4q5qPPGwA434sFW